Why ABBA works in Wales
Welsh audiences have a particular relationship with communal music – the tradition of singing together, of a room finding a common voice. Few catalogues lend themselves to that as readily as ABBA’s. The Winner Takes It All, Dancing Queen, Mamma Mia – these are songs that audiences know from beginning to end and are happy to sing. FABBAGIRLS build their shows around that energy rather than asking a room to be passive.
The performance
A full FABBAGIRLS show includes choreography, professional costumes and live harmonies drawn from the complete ABBA catalogue. The production adapts to the venue – from a city-centre hotel ballroom in Cardiff to a country estate in the Vale of Glamorgan. An optional second set of 70s and 80s classics extends the evening for events that want more after the main show.

Do FABBAGIRLS perform in Cardiff and South Wales?
Yes. Cardiff and the surrounding area – the Vale of Glamorgan, Newport, Swansea and the wider South Wales region – are all within the regular booking geography.
Are they suitable for weddings at Welsh countryside venues and country houses?
Yes. Rural estate and country house weddings are a significant part of the calendar. The duo format works particularly well for venues where a full band setup is impractical or where the intimate character of the setting matters.
What types of events do they typically perform at in Cardiff?
Corporate dinners and awards evenings, charity galas, private parties and wedding receptions across Cardiff and South Wales.
What booking configurations are available?
Duo, four-piece, six-piece, or with a disco set extension. Full orchestral productions are available by arrangement for larger occasions.
What does a typical set include?
The full ABBA catalogue – Dancing Queen, Voulez-Vous, The Winner Takes It All, Super Trouper, Mamma Mia, Waterloo and more. Set lists are agreed with Susie in advance and can be tailored to the event and the audience.
How far in advance should we book?
Summer wedding dates and corporate gala evenings fill quickly. Six to twelve months ahead is recommended for events with fixed dates.
